The Impact of Smoke and Soot Damage…
Many property owners are surprised to discover that smoke damage often extends well beyond the area directly affected by fire.
Smoke and soot can impact:
- Walls and ceilings
- Flooring
- Furniture
- Cabinets
- HVAC systems
- Personal belongings
Prompt cleanup helps reduce permanent staining and lingering odors.

Can smoke damage affect rooms that were not burned?
Yes. Smoke and soot particles can travel throughout a property and affect multiple rooms.

Can firefighting efforts cause water damage?
Yes. Water used to extinguish a fire can create significant secondary water damage that requires professional drying and mitigation.
